Susie Zielin

Registered Psychologist

About

Susie is a registered psychologist with experience in private, public, and forensic settings. Her areas of interest include the assessment of neurodevelopmental conditions such as intellectual disability, specific learning disorders, autism, and attention deficit hyperactivity disorder. She acknowledges that neurodevelopmental conditions can have significant academic, social, communication, behavioural and psychological impacts. 


Susie values a client-centred approach to assessment and aims to work from a neurodiversity-affirming perspective. She is passionate about providing every individual with the opportunity to understand themselves better, particularly their strengths, differences, and support needs. 


Susie’s gentle and warm approach aims to create a respectful, safe, and supportive space for clients to express themselves and build upon their existing skills and strengths. Susie focuses on building positive working relationships and approaches all clients from a place of non-judgement, empathy, and understanding.


Susie is also an AHPRA Board-Approved Supervisor.
